Overview
- UFC CEO Dana White declared ‘‘Jon agreed to fight Tom, fact’’ during the UFC 316 post-fight press conference and said a Tuesday meeting will finalize logistics.
- Tom Aspinall captured the interim heavyweight crown in November 2023, defended it once and publicly questioned Jones’s commitment by calling him retired.
- Jones hasn’t fought since his TKO win over Stipe Miocic in November 2024 and had sought six months of preparation and a substantial purse before signing the bout agreement.
- The heavyweight division’s progression has stalled amid prolonged negotiations, prompting fans and contenders to urge the UFC to strip Jones if the fight isn’t sealed.
- On his YouTube channel, Aspinall hinted at a ‘‘something big’’ announcement this week and stressed he would only retire if he ever began ducking opponents.
